Sept. 20, 1723

“Edict” issued by Georg I of Great Britain [Present-day England and Germany; Electorate of Hannover]: “[…] IV) […] if the Jewish Easter/Easter of Jews (‘Juden Ostern’) falls on the same day per the improved calendar [as the Christian], like for example as in 1778 or 1798, and no other/proper time can to be found by consulting the commonly used Rudolphian Table (‘Tabulae Rudolphinae’)[…] and approved by the Evangeline church (‘corpore Evangelicorum’), the[ir] Easter-fest is to be postponed by 8 days […] in order to maintain the intentions of the Council of Nicaea (‘Concilii Nicaeni’) […]”
